Development and application of a methodology for the classification of the operating conditions of power transformers; Desarrollo y aplicacion de una metodologia para la clasificacion del estado operativo de transformadores de potencia

Abstract

This thesis work shows the development of a classification model that allows the user to assess the operative condition of power transformers. The proposed model includes the following steps: Relative weights assignation for each IEEE-62-1995 required test. Those relative weights are obtained from test results and standardized and experience based limits obtained by Comision Federal de Electricidad (CFE). Once the relative weights have been assigned, three states, green, yellow and red were defined. Each state was then ranked with a weight number (1, 2 or 3). Specific weights were assigned for each test included in the model. Test score assignation takes into account the product of the relative value and the specific weight of each test. Transformer risk assessment uses the total score obtained from the sum of the tests partial scores. Transformer risk assessment was then classified in three categories. Total score causes the system to issue maintenance or substitution recommendations. The described model will improve maintenance scheduling according the transformer risk assessment and it is fully applicable to the complete CFE power transformer population.
